The Trails and Bridges
One of the standout features of Foxfire Mountain is the variety of scenic hiking trails that take you through Tennessee’s lush landscapes. These trails are described as easy to moderate, making them accessible for most ages and fitness levels. As you wander along, you’ll encounter different types of bridges—from traditional log bridges to charming covered ones, and the highlight: the 335-foot swinging bridge.
We loved the way the swinging bridge stretches across Foxfire Gorge, rising 70 feet above the water, giving you a thrilling yet safe crossing. Travelers have called it “relaxing” and “fun to walk over,” confirming that the bridge isn’t just a photo op but a satisfying experience in itself. Be prepared for some gentle sway, and remember that the views of the gorge and surrounding woods make the walk worthwhile.
Waterfalls and Historic Sites
Along the trails, you’ll find several scenic stops, like Lost Mine Falls—a peaceful cascade that’s perfect for photos or a brief rest—and the Sweden Furnace Iron Mine, a historic site that adds a hint of Tennessee’s industrial past. These stops break up the hike and give you a chance to appreciate the natural and historical layers of the area.
One reviewer mentioned the hike to the waterfall as “a wonderful workout,” indicating that while the terrain is manageable, it still offers some physical engagement. The opportunity to combine outdoor activity with a touch of history gives this experience added depth, especially for those curious about the region.
The Whispering Winds Covered Bridge
A particular highlight is the Whispering Winds Covered Bridge, a whimsical spot filled with thousands of hanging wishes. It’s a charming and interactive feature that adds a fairy-tale feel to your adventure. Many visitors find it “home to thousands of wishes hanging from the ceiling,” creating a magical ambiance perfect for children’s imagination—or simply a fun photo moment.

For those who want a little more adventure, the tree-top canopy tour in the Evergreen Grotto offers a unique perspective high above the ground. It’s a guided walk through the treetops that will appeal to families and nature lovers wanting a different view of the landscape.
Meanwhile, the Littlest Adventurer Obstacle Course caters to kids and the young at heart. This on-the-ground course offers a safe but engaging challenge, encouraging little ones to build confidence and have fun. One reviewer noted that their children “really enjoyed the outdoor activities,” confirming the course’s appeal for families.
Relaxing Spots and Picnics
Not all of Foxfire Mountain’s appeal is adrenaline or views. The River Walk Trail offers a leisurely stroll alongside Dunns Creek, perfect for relaxing or enjoying a picnic. Visitors can bring their own food and settle into one of the many cozy spots, or just unwind on the porch with rockers, soaking in the peaceful environment.
